[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]
『勤務換算表の作成』(Teddy)
いつもお世話になっております。
以前、こちらでご教授いただき勤務換算表を作成いたしました。
A B C D E AF AG AH
1 1 2 3 4 31
2一郎 H H 休 0.5
3次郎 休 年 I6 0.8
4花子 N 1
5
6太郎 6ウ 休 4ウ 0.5 or 0.7
. . . 25
こんな表です。AH列に常勤換算の値を入れています。
B25〜AF25にその日の出勤者を常勤換算した値をSUMIFSで計算するように入力しています。B25=SUMIFS($AH$2:$AH$23,B2:B23,"?*",B2:B23,"<>休",B2:B23,"<>年",B2:B23,"<>特")な感じです。
ここに、今回新入職の人を追加したいのですが、この人の条件がこれまでと異なっているので、どう追加したらよいかわからず困っています。
これまでの職員は、休みや年休以外は基本的にはAH列に入れている換算値で計算すればよかったのでシンプルだったのですが、今回の方は「4ウ」勤務であれば0.5、「6ウ」勤務であれば0.7で計算しなくてはいけません。
一人の人に換算値を2つ使わなければならないため、単純にこれまでの表に追加ができません。
ご指導のほど、よろしくお願いいたします。
< 使用 Excel:Excel2016、使用 OS:unknown >
の続きみたいですよ ^^; m(_ _)m (隠居Z) 2022/01/11(火) 16:23
(Teddy) 2022/01/11(火) 17:01
太郎さんのAH列(換算値)にはとりあえず「0.5」を入力しておき、それで合計を出す。 太郎さんが「6ウ」だったら、0.2(0.5と0.7の差)を合計に加算する。
つまり、太郎さんが6行目だとすれば B25 =SUMIFS($AH$2:$AH$23,B2:B23,"?*",B2:B23,"<>休",B2:B23,"<>年",B2:B23,"<>特")+IF(B6="6ウ",0.2,0) ~~~~~~~~~~~~~~~~~~~ 右コピー ※「6ウ」の「6」は半角、「ウ」は全角だとして
例外が次から次と出てくると収拾がつかなくなりそうですけど、とりあえず一人だけなら・・・
以上 (笑) 2022/01/11(火) 17:47
無事に解決いたしました。
いつもありがとうございます。大変助かりました。
(Teddy) 2022/01/12(水) 09:15
[ 一覧(最新更新順) ]
Y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ki.
Modified by kazu.